Chicago sues Airbnb and host company over alleged short-term rental violations
Chicago is suing Airbnb and host company Slumber Stay for alleged violations of its short-term rental regulations. The city claims nearly 200 violations were issued over 2024-2025, citing issues with licensing and platform data sharing, highlighting enforcement challenges.
